    The Single-Zero Advantage: Why It Matters

    The most significant difference between European and American roulette comes down to mathematics, and the numbers are impossible to ignore. With just one zero on the wheel, the house edge drops to 2.70 percent, compared to the 5.26 percent found on American tables. That difference might seem small on paper, but over an extended session, it translates into substantial savings for the player.     The La Partage Rule: A European Gift to American Players

    One of the most attractive features of European roulette is the La Partage rule, which is frequently offered at online casinos catering to American players. Under this rule, if the ball lands on zero, you lose only half of your even-money bet, with the other half returned to you. This provision effectively cuts the house edge on red/black, odd/even, and high/low bets in half, bringing the overall advantage down to an impressive 1.35 percent.

    What is a percentage betting strategy online

    A percentage betting strategy online means you risk a fixed fraction of your current bankroll on each wager. For example, if you decide to bet 2% of your total funds, and you have $1,000, your first bet is $20. If you win and your bankroll grows to $1,050, your next bet becomes $21. If you lose and your bankroll drops to $980, your next bet shrinks to $19.60. This dynamic adjustment keeps your risk proportional to your available capital.

    This is fundamentally different from the “flat bet” approach popular in many Atlantic City card rooms, where players bet the same dollar amount regardless of wins or losses. The percentage method protects you from ruin during a bad stretch and allows your bankroll to compound during a hot streak. It’s the same principle that professional sports bettors and blackjack card counters have used for decades, now adapted for the speed of online wagering.

    How to calculate your bet size

    The first step is deciding your percentage. Most experts recommend between 1% and 5% per bet, depending on the game’s variance. For example, in a low-variance game like video poker, you might comfortably bet 3%. For high-variance slots or sports accumulator bets, 1% is safer. Once you pick a percentage, you simply multiply your current bankroll by that number.

    Let’s say you have a starting bankroll of $500. You choose 2%. Your first bet is $10. After a win, your bankroll is $510, so your next bet is $10.20. After a loss, your bankroll is $490, so your next bet is $9.80. This automatic recalculation removes the temptation to “chase” losses by increasing your stake. Many online platforms now offer built-in bet-sizing tools, but you can also track it manually with a spreadsheet.
